Barbers Salary in All 36 States

# State Median Salary Mean Salary Employment
1 Oregon $77,430 $83,650 N/A
2 Illinois $65,430 $55,540 N/A
3 Colorado $61,500 $59,140 480
4 Washington $61,150 $67,540 1,220
5 Iowa $58,900 $54,470 130
6 New Jersey $54,850 $54,080 N/A
7 Minnesota $53,990 $49,400 260
8 Florida $49,410 $52,980 1,240
9 North Dakota $48,540 $46,770 80
10 Missouri $47,880 $55,900 580
11 Virginia $46,730 $51,480 160
12 Louisiana $44,430 $42,270 40
13 Connecticut $41,400 $42,120 330
14 New Mexico $39,100 $38,760 50
15 Nebraska $39,090 $43,950 N/A
16 New York $38,580 $44,760 N/A
17 Mississippi $38,480 $38,840 N/A
18 California $38,380 $47,720 1,390
19 Pennsylvania $36,920 $37,630 530
20 Wisconsin $36,540 $43,210 450
21 Idaho $36,040 $37,810 130
22 Michigan $35,490 $44,490 N/A
23 Maryland $35,400 $44,680 N/A
24 Maine $35,300 $46,800 50
25 Rhode Island $34,900 $41,740 N/A
26 Oklahoma $34,860 $34,400 170
27 Arizona $34,380 $35,050 N/A
28 Indiana $33,600 $40,760 370
29 South Carolina $32,900 $44,600 220
30 North Carolina $31,050 $47,710 330
31 Texas $30,760 $41,630 2,580
32 Georgia $30,750 $46,110 550
33 Alabama $29,120 $28,320 N/A
34 Arkansas $25,640 $28,260 170
35 Utah $25,370 $25,890 320
36 Tennessee $24,690 $29,460 N/A
